You may already know that cerebral palsy affects thousands of newborns across America due to misconduct medical or natural causes. May, but you wonder how you want to know if your child may seem healthy but really develops palsy brain in the first two years of life. When an infant or child suffers brain damage, they are several symptoms that can be reported to you and your doctors that something was wrong in May to the health of your child. In the first months after birth, an infant with brain damage in May show some or all of the following symptoms, which indicate changes in May of cerebral palsy and other disabilities:
* Lack of alertness
* Irritability and constant dull
* Abnormal, high-pitched cry
* The tremor of the arms and legs
* Ability to eat, poor sucking and swallowing
Low muscle tone * Once your child reaches six months of age, it should become clear whether he or she is recovering basic motor skills or learning slower than normal. Infants with a disability cerebral palsy develop physically and mentally slower. Simple activities like rolling over, sitting, crawling, walking and talking may prove difficult for your child if they are developing or have cerebral palsy. Why would there be a delay of diagnosis? In some cases, physicians May delay in the diagnosis of a child with cerebral palsy. This is partly due to the fact that disability is the plasticity of the nervous system central to a child and it is difficult to determine to what extent a child is the ability to recover from any trauma, he or she may have encountered during childbirth. It is also difficult to say the amount of brain damage that has occurred in the first few months of life.
It has been proved that the brains of very young children can be repaired more easily and more quickly than adults. This is why it is so important that if your delivery has not complications and your child seems healthy, you see your doctor regularly to have your baby checked. Cerebral palsy can be diagnosed by a thorough examination of your child's current health status. During a review of motor skills your child will analyzed and the doctor will look for unusual movements less than average muscle tone, and other developmental delays.
